Debanne Road - streets of McLeansville (North Carolina).
Explore "Debanne Road" on the map of McLeansville in street view mode
Click on the buttons below to display the map of Debanne Road, McLeansville, United States
Search street by name:
Tags:
Debanne Road on the map of McLeansville,
McLeansville satellite view, McLeansville street view.